Bhutan –Anthrax, human, livestock
23 September 2010
Kuensel Online [edited] [ProMed]
At least one person has died of suspected pulmonary anthrax and about 8 people were affected with anthrax as of 15 September 2010. A total of 25 cattle, 8 horses/mules, 4 pigs, and 6 cats were also reported dead due to the anthrax outbreak.

Bangladesh- Anthrax, human, bovine alert
6 September 2010
The Telegraph, Calcutta [edited] [ProMED]
India could be staring at a possible anthrax outbreak with Bangladesh sounding a red alert that the contagious disease, anthrax, has infected over 325 people in that country since mid-August 2010. The disease, transmitted from infected cattle to humans through handling of the animals or consumption of meat, has spread in 4 Bangladesh districts. Bangladesh is known for trading with India.
